Vegetable Soup and Biscuits



I made this simple vegetable soup the other day when I was sick.
It really helped! I'm sure any combination of vegetables
would work. And these easy biscuits were great for dipping!

Soup

7 cups vegetable stock
1 onion
1 carrot
1 large potato
1/2 zucchini
1/2 green pepper
1 garlic clove, minced
salt, pepper, rosemary

Bring 7 cups of stock to boil in large pot.
Chop onion, carrot, pepper, zucchini, and potato and add to stock.
Add garlic, pepper, salt and rosemary to taste.
Lower heat and cook till vegetables are tender.


Biscuits

2 1/4 cups white flour
1/4 whole wheat flour (or you could use all whole wheat flour, like I did)
1 tsp sugar
1 tsp baking powder
1 tsp baking soda
1/4 tsp salt
3 tbs butter
3/4 & 2 tbs milk

Preheat oven 400 degrees.
Mix everything except butter and milk.
Then add melted butter and milk and mix well.
Place biscuit batter on cookie sheet about an inch thick
and three inches wide (I think I made about nine).
Place in oven and bake for about 18-20 minutes.

TVP Enchiladas



These non-traditional enchiladas are so filling!
I made them the other night with whatever I
had around. They turned out great.

1 cup cooked tvp
1 onion
1 green pepper
1 red pepper
1/2 can black beans
1/2 jar salsa
1/4 cup tomato sauce
1/2 tsp Worcestershire sauce
1/2 tsp balsalmic vinegar
1 cup cheese, shredded
4 whole wheat tortillas

Preheat oven to 350 degrees.
Chop the onion and peppers and saute till fully cooked and brown.
Add balsamic vinegar, Worcestershire sauce, and tomato sauce to TVP and mix well.
Place tortillas side by side in a shallow casserole dish.
Place beans, TVP, onions, peppers and some shredded cheese inside each.
Fold up tortillas, and pour salsa on top. Sprinkle the of the shredded cheese on top.
Bake for about 10-15 minutes.
